South Basildon and East Thurrock

Shows the general election results for South Basildon and East Thurrock, which is a constituency in Essex. In 2017 it had a total electorate of 73,537 and a turnout of 64.1%.

Party results and changes 2015 - 2017

Results for each party with number of votes, percentage share of the vote and changes since last election.

Candidate Party Votes Vote (%) Change (%)
Stephen Metcalfe  Con 26,811 56.9 13.5
Byron Taylor  Lab 15,321 32.5 7.3
Peter Whittle  UKIP 3,193 6.8 -19.8
Reetendra Banerji * LD 732 1.6 -1.4
Sim Harman * Green 680 1.4 1.4
Paul Borg * BNP 383 0.8 0.8
* Candidate lost their deposit
